Clip - Product Feedback ? -------------------- Drop (a) product feedback, (b) feature ideas, or (c) Reddit frustrations in the comments. About Clip: ELI5: Like Reddit, but people earn from posting and commenting Our goal is to find PMF i.e answer these 3 questions: 1. Crypto-Native: Is /c/crypto fun enough for daily use (readers + traders)? 2. Normie-Friendly: Can we grow channels beyond crypto? 3. Scalable Playbook: Can we repeatedly launch high-quality, positive-sum channels? After PMF: Go after Reddit with the first major Web3 “vampire attack.” Risks: 1. Smart contracts are currently unaudited. Ape responsibly. 2. We’re in Beta and shipping fast: expect bugs.

This is cool conceptually but needs some serious additional thought in terms of onboarding (must be seamless, shouldn’t require email, should be able to auth with Warpcast or wallet) as well as UX/UI design. Right now, the interface feels disjointed - more emphasis on where a user should be looking, more “flow” from step to step, an optional dark mode (maybe even enabled by default…?) and some splashes of color would go a long way. There’s room to make this more exciting and fun to engage with. I also wonder if this might work better as a PWA, vs in browser only? Or perhaps even better than that - deploy it as a Farcaster Mini App (formerly Frames) The concept is strong, I see the vision… I just think some more thought is needed to make this accessible, fun, sleek, attractive, and engaging, such that people log in and use the platform but also keep coming back.
